Why Review Costing Legally?
Conditions carry money: who pays new taxes, whether escalation applies, how long retention is held, and what the defect liability really costs. These numbers belong in your bid price, not in a later dispute.
Additionally, ambiguous scope items become free work if unchallenged. We flag them before submission, so you either price them or query them at the pre-bid stage.

How is this different from the risk assessment service?
The risk assessment grades legal risk (red-amber-green) for a go/no-go decision. This review goes further into money: it converts clauses into rupee amounts for your bid price. Many contractors take both together at a combined fee.
Will you see my bid price?
Only if you share it, and it stays confidential. Most clients share the draft BOQ so our costing inputs land in the right items. We are bound by professional confidentiality in every engagement.
Can a review really prevent disqualification?
Yes. A surprising share of bids fail on unsigned annexures, missing declarations or wrong EMD formats. Our submission-guard checklist catches exactly those. It is the fastest value in the whole review.
